Highlights

On average, there are 176 sunny days per year in Newport. Coeur d'Alene averages 174 sunny days per year. The US average is 205 sunny days.

Newport, Washington gets 27 inches of rain, on average, per year. Coeur d'Alene, Idaho gets 26.6 inches of rain, on average, per year. The US average is 38.1 inches of rain per year.

Newport averages 60.9 inches of snow per year. Coeur d'Alene averages 42.4 inches of snow per year. The US average is 27.8 inches of snow per year.

August is the hottest month for Coeur d'Alene with an average high temperature of 82.1°, which ranks it as cooler than most places in Idaho. In Coeur d'Alene, there are 4 comfortable months with high temperatures in the range of 70-85°. The most pleasant months of the year for Coeur d'Alene are July, August and June.

July is the hottest month for Newport with an average high temperature of 82.7°, which ranks it as warmer than most places in Washington. In Newport, there are 4 comfortable months with high temperatures in the range of 70-85°. The most pleasant months of the year for Newport are June, August and July.
December has the coldest nighttime temperatures for Coeur d'Alene with an average of 23.8°. This is one of the warmest places in Idaho.

December has the coldest nighttime temperatures for Newport with an average of 19.8°. This is one of the coldest places in Washington.

In Coeur d'Alene, there are 13.8 days annually when the high temperature is over 90°, which is cooler than most places in Idaho.

In Newport, there are 14.0 days annually when the high temperature is over 90°, which is hotter than most places in Washington.

In Coeur d'Alene, there are 129.4 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below freezing, which is warmer than most places in Idaho.

In Newport, there are 175.1 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below freezing, which is one of the coldest places in Washington.

In Coeur d'Alene, there are 1.9 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below zero°, which is one of the warmest places in Idaho.

In Newport, there are 4.7 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below zero°, which is one of the coldest places in Washington.

November is the wettest month in Coeur d'Alene with 3.8 inches of rain, and the driest month is August with 0.9 inches. The wettest season is Spring with 34% of yearly precipitation and 15% occurs in Autumn, which is the driest season. The annual rainfall of 26.6 inches in Coeur d'Alene means that it is wetter than most places in Idaho.


December is the wettest month in Newport with 3.7 inches of rain, and the driest month is August with 1.0 inches. The wettest season is Spring with 33% of yearly precipitation and 16% occurs in Autumn, which is the driest season. The annual rainfall of 27.0 inches in Newport means that it is drier than most places in Washington.

November is the rainiest month in Coeur d'Alene with 15.0 days of rain, and August is the driest month with only 4.4 rainy days. There are 122.1 rainy days annually in Coeur d'Alene, which is rainier than most places in Idaho. The rainiest season is Spring when it rains 31% of the time and the driest is Autumn with only a 15% chance of a rainy day.

November is the rainiest month in Newport with 14.3 days of rain, and August is the driest month with only 4.9 rainy days. There are 123.7 rainy days annually in Newport, which is less rainy than most places in Washington. The rainiest season is Spring when it rains 31% of the time and the driest is Autumn with only a 17% chance of a rainy day.

An annual snowfall of 42.4 inches in Coeur d'Alene means that it is about average compared to other places in Idaho.

An annual snowfall of 60.9 inches in Newport means that it is one of the snowiest places in Washington.
December is the snowiest month in Coeur d'Alene with 15.8 inches of snow, and 5 months of the year have significant snowfall.

December is the snowiest month in Newport with 22.8 inches of snow, and 5 months of the year have significant snowfall.

DID YOU KNOW?

Many people confuse Weather and Climate, but they are different. Weather refers to the conditions of the atmosphere over a short period of time, while Climate refers to the conditions of the atmosphere over a long period of time.

Weather, more specifically, refers to how the atmosphere behaves and its effects on life and human activities. Most people think of Weather in terms of what can be observed: temperature, humidity, precipitation, and cloudy/sunny conditions. Weather conditions constantly change on a minute-to-minute basis.

Climate is a record of the average weather conditions for a given place over a long period of time, often referred to as Climate Normals. A 30-year period of record is a common requirement to be considered a Climate Normal.
